THE WORD ON YOUR LIPS


THE WORD ON YOUR LIPS
For with the heart man believeth unto 
righteousness; and with the mouth 
confession is made unto salvation 
(Romans 10:10).
t u e s d a y 19
It’s  not  enough  to  know  God’s  Word  as  it’s 
contained in the written pages of the Bible; you 
have to release power through speaking! That’s how 
it works! With the Word on your lips, you’ll live over 
and above all limitations and circumstances. 
Voicing  your  faith  is  a  fundamental  spiritual 
principle,  without  which  even  the  gift  and  blessing 
of  salvation  can’t  be  received  or  activated.  Notice 
the  opening  verse  again:  “For  with  the  heart  man 
believeth  unto  righteousness;  and  with  the  mouth 
confession is made unto salvation” (Romans 10:10). 
The salvation package is delivered upon satisfying 
these  two  conditions:  Believing  and  confessing  the 
Lordship  of  Jesus.  To  believe  isn’t  enough;  there 
must be the corresponding verbal communication or 
affirmation of your faith. 
When you speak the Word, what you’re doing is 
releasing the power of God into action on your behalf. 
For  example,  God  instructed  Joshua, “This  book  of 
the law shall not depart out of thy mouth; but thou 
shalt meditate therein day and night, that thou mayest 
observe to do according to all that is written therein: 
for  then  thou  shalt  make  thy  way  prosperous,  and 
then thou shalt have good success” (Joshua 1:8). 
The Hebrew rendering of the word “meditate” is 
“hagah,” which means to ponder, imagine, murmur, 
mutter,  speak,  study,  talk,  utter,  or  roar.  It’s  not  just 
talking  about  you  thinking  the  Word  only,  it  means 
you ought to voice out the Word. 
Notice that the instruction to Joshua doesn’t make 
any mention of us speaking to anyone. So, it makes no 
difference whether or not anyone is listening to you, 
you just keep talking the Word. When matters arise, 
use the Word. Speak the Word and change things. The 
Word of God in your mouth is God talking.
